
免费的程序编辑软件、免费的程序编辑软件手机版 ,对于想了解建站百科知识的朋友们来说,免费的程序编辑软件、免费的程序编辑软件手机版是一个非常想了解的问题,下面小编就带领大家看看这个问题。
想象一下,无需投入一分钱,你就能获得媲美专业级的代码编写环境。这不再是幻想,而是开源运动与社区协作带来的现实。免费的程序编辑软件,如Visual Studio Code、IntelliJ IDEA Community Edition等,已经打破了技术与经济的壁垒。而它们的手机版本,则将编程的灵活性推向了新的高度——无论你是在通勤路上、咖啡馆小憩,还是睡前灵感迸发,都能随时捕捉并实现创意。本文将带你系统梳理这些宝藏工具,不仅告诉你它们是什么,更深入剖析其核心优势、适用场景与未来趋势,助你在数字创造的浪潮中抢占先机。

在桌面编程领域,免费编辑器已经实现了对付费工具的全面超越。以微软推出的Visual Studio Code为例,它凭借轻量级的设计、极快的启动速度和海量的扩展插件库,成为了全球开发者的首选。其内置的智能代码补全、语法高亮、集成终端和强大的调试支持,让编写代码成为一种流畅的体验。更重要的是,它完美支持JavaScript、Python、Java、C++等数十种主流语言,几乎涵盖了所有开发场景。

另一款不可忽视的利器是JetBrains系列的社区版,如IntelliJ IDEA(Java)、PyCharm(Python)和CLion(C/C++)。这些工具虽然提供付费的专业版,但其社区版功能已足够强大,特别在代码分析、重构和项目导航方面表现出色,深受中高级开发者喜爱。它们为特定语言提供了深度定化的环境,能极大提升开发效率与代码质量。

对于追求极致轻量与可定制性的用户,Sublime Text和Atom(虽已停止更新,但仍有大量用户)曾是经典选择。而如今,由GitHub开发并开源的VSCode几乎一统江湖,其成功的核心在于活跃的社区。数百万开发者共同贡献插件,使得任何特殊需求几乎都能找到现成解决方案,形成了一个生生不息的生态系统。
随着移动设备性能的飞跃,在手机或平板上编写代码已从概念变为实用的生产力场景。这类应用巧妙地将触屏操作的便利性与编程的核心需求相结合。例如,Acode、Dcoder和Pythonista(针对iOS)等应用,不仅提供了语法高亮和代码补全,甚至集成了本地运行环境或连接远程服务器的能力,让你能直接测试脚本效果。
移动编辑器的最大价值在于其“随时随地”的特性。它非常适合进行代码片段练习、学习新语法、快速修复线上bug或审阅Pull Request。对于学习者而言,可以利用碎片时间反复练习;对于运维人员,它则是一个强大的应急工具。许多应用还支持与GitHub、GitLab等代码托管平台直接同步,确保了工作的连续性。
移动编程也存在天然局限。屏幕尺寸限制了同时查看的代码量,虚拟键盘输入效率不及物理键盘,且复杂项目的构建与管理仍显吃力。手机版编辑器目前更多是作为桌面环境的补充,而非替代。但它的存在,无疑将编程的时空边界大大拓宽,象征着编程活动日益平民化和生活化。
免费编程工具蓬勃发展的基石,是强大的开源生态与社区文化。这些工具本身大多就是开源项目,其代码公开,接受全球开发者的检视与贡献。这意味着它们的安全性、可靠性和创新速度往往优于闭源软件。用户不仅是使用者,也可以是改进者,这种模式催生了惊人的进化速度。
社区的力量体现在方方面面:从堆积如山的教程、问答论坛(如Stack Overflow上的海量相关问题),到用户自发翻译的多语言界面,再到针对特定框架或语言的专用插件包。当一个工具遇到问题时,你通常能快速在社区中找到解决方案或直接向开发者反馈。这种集体智慧的支持体系,极大降低了学习和使用门槛。
开源生态也促进了工具之间的集成与标准化。例如,许多编辑器都支持Language Server Protocol协议,这使得为不同编辑器添加对同一语言的支持变得统一且高效。开发者无论选择哪款工具,都能获得一致的核心体验,从而可以更自由地根据偏好选择界面和工作流,而非被工具绑架。
面对功能丰富的免费编辑器,新手常会感到无所适从。关键在于理解:强大的功能并非需要一次性掌握。大多数优秀编辑器都遵循“开箱即用”原则,基础编辑功能直观易懂。深入的学习是一个渐进过程,你可以按需探索插件、快捷键和高级设置,将其逐步打磨成最趁手的兵器。
个性化定制是免费编辑器的灵魂所在。从主题颜色、字体、图标,到每一处键盘快捷键映射、代码片段模板,几乎一切皆可调整。你可以将界面打造成自己喜欢的任何风格,也可以将重复性操作简化为一个命令。这个过程本身,就是一种充满成就感的编程实践。网络上分享的配置方案(如“VSCode设置分享”)更是成为了一种独特的文化。
建立高效的工作流比单纯堆砌功能更重要。这涉及如何组织项目文件、如何利用版本控制集成、如何配置调试环境、如何运行测试等。免费编辑器在这些方面提供了极大的灵活性,允许你结合自身习惯,搭建独一无二的开发环境。这份“塑造工具”的能力,是付费软件标准化流程所无法赋予的。
现代开发往往需要在不同设备间切换。免费的编辑器在这方面表现卓越,Visual Studio Code、Sublime Text等主流工具都提供Windows、macOS和Linux版本,且配置可以通过云同步。这意味着你在办公室电脑上的所有设置、插件和项目状态,回家后可以在个人电脑上无缝恢复。
云开发环境是未来的重要趋势。GitHub Codespaces、Gitpod等基于浏览器的IDE,本质上提供了配置好的、包含编辑器的完整Linux容器。它们与免费编辑器理念一脉相承——无需本地安装复杂环境,打开浏览器就能获得一致的开发体验。虽然部分服务高级功能收费,但其核心免费层已足够个人项目使用。
这种“环境即代码”的模式,将编程工具推向了更高的抽象层。开发者关注点更集中于代码本身,而由云服务解决环境依赖问题。免费编辑器与这些云服务的深度集成(如VSCode可远程连接至这些环境),使得从本地到云的过渡平滑自然。未来,编程工具的形态可能进一步演化,但免费、开放、协作的核心精神必将延续。
使用免费工具时,安全与隐私是不容忽视的议题。开源编辑器由于代码透明,在安全方面往往更受信任,漏洞能被社区快速发现和修复。但用户也需谨慎对待第三方插件,只从官方市场或可信来源安装,并定期更新,以规避恶意代码风险。
在隐私方面,需注意编辑器可能收集的遥测数据。大多数工具会明确询问是否允许发送匿名使用数据以帮助改进产品,用户可根据自身偏好选择禁用。对于处理敏感项目的开发者,可以选择完全离线使用,或使用注重隐私的替代品。
免费模式的可持续发展依赖于健康的生态。虽然软件本身免费,但许多公司通过提供云服务、专业支持、托管解决方案或专属插件来获得收入,以此反哺开源项目的开发和维护。作为用户,在享受免费红利的积极参与社区、提交反馈、赞助优秀项目,都是支持其长期发展的重要方式。
从功能强悍、生态繁荣的桌面端免费编辑器,到灵活便捷、突破时空限制的手机版应用,我们正处在一个编程工具最好的免费时代。它们降低了技术门槛,让创意得以快速验证;它们依靠开源与社区,实现了前所未有的进化速度与可靠性。无论是初学者踏出第一步,还是资深开发者构建复杂系统,都能在其中找到得力的助手。
未来,随着云原生、人工智能辅助编程等技术的发展,这些工具将变得更加智能和无处不在。但核心不变的是,它们将继续扮演“创造力放大器”的角色。选择并精通一套适合自己的免费编程工具,不仅仅是掌握了一些软件,更是获得了一种在数字世界中自由构建、表达和解决问题的能力。现在,就打开你的编辑器,开始书写下一行改变世界的代码吧。
以上是关于免费的程序编辑软件、免费的程序编辑软件手机版的介绍,希望对想了解建站百科知识的朋友们有所帮助。
本文标题:免费的程序编辑软件、免费的程序编辑软件手机版;本文链接:https://zwz66.cn/jianz/267355.html。
Copyright © 2002-2027 小虎建站知识网 版权所有 网站备案号: 苏ICP备18016903号-19
苏公网安备32031202000909